Auburn Takes Over SEC Network August 2nd-3rd

Auburn fans may want to set their VCR’s to the SEC Network this Thursday and Friday. For the fourth consecutive year the network will be giving each of the 14 SEC schools 24 hours of broadcast time to promotes their athletic programs. Auburn’s time begins at 11 p.m. CT Thursday and runs through 11 p.m. Friday. Two SEC Storied documentaries and nine special moments from the 2017-18 season have been chosen to be highlighted.

Fans can relive SEC Championships in men’s basketball, football, golf, and equestrian. The two documentaries will be about women’s basketball legend, Ruthie Bolten and Auburn’s three-time Olympic gold medalist Rowdy Gaines.

It will be worth your time to catch the replay of the Tigers’ 40-17 beatdown of No. 1 Georgia at 3-6 p.m. and then catch the 26-14 domination of No.1 Alabama in the Iron Bowl at 8-11 p.m.

Here’s the complete broadcast schedule for the Tigers:

Thursday:
11 p.m. Thursday – 2 a.m. Fri. CT – Men’s golf SEC Championship

Friday:
2 am. – 4 a.m. – Women’s soccer vs. Florida

4 a.m. – 5 a.m. – SEC Storied: “Mighty Ruthie” documentary of Ruthie Bolten

5 a.m. – 7:30 a.m. – Auburn baseball’s Casey Mize no-hitter against Northeastern

7:30 a.m. – 9:30 a.m. – Auburn Men’s basketball vs. South Carolina

9:30 a.m. – 11 a.m. – Women’s gymnastics 2016 win vs. Alabama

11 a.m – noon – SEC Storied: “Rowdy” – documentary of Rowdy Gaines

Noon – 3 p.m. – Baseball vs. N.C. State: NCAA Regional championship over NC State
3 p.m. – 6 p.m. – Football’s blow out of Georgia
6p.m. – 8 p.m. – Men’s basketball win over Alabama
8 p.m. – 11 p.m. – Auburn Football humbles Alabama in the Iron Bowl
